Thanks for your bug report.

I can confirm the problem, 1.08-2 fails in a stable chroot (and also
in an unstable chroot). 1.09-1 passes in stable (and unstable), and
the upstream changelog for 1.09 says:

+    Bugfixes:
+    - SSL tests failed due to expired CA certificate.
+      Just created new certificates with 30 year
+      expiration and put a gen.sh script inside to
+      easily generate new certificates after that
+      period ;)

and the certs in /t/ssl/ are indeed renewed.


So the bug only affects 1.08-2 in stable and is caused by the expired
certificate(s) in the package itself.

If we want to fix this in stretch, we probably have to just update
t/ssl/. Or skip t/04.cnct-auth-ssl-verifypeer-wrongca.t (and maybe
also t/04.cnct-auth-ssl-verifypeer.t).
